Many people in Kirkheaton will have fond memories of Patrick (Pat) Harris who died in December 2020. He was Rector of  Kirkheaton from 1980 to 1985 after spending  a number of years as Bishop of  Northern Argentina. Here he learned the language and gained the love of the Wichi people who gave him the affectionate name “Kahyentes”, meaning “Encourager.”

Pat oversaw significant changes at St John’s church. He will be remembered by his former congregation for his love of people and his irrepressible humour. Soon after arrival in the village, a little old lady, a member of the congregation, looked up and down his six-foot figure and pronounced, “Thou’lt do,” to which Pat replied, “Thou’lt do, too.”

On leaving Kirkheaton he was a bishop for 47 years and in addition to Northern Argentina and Southwell, served as an Assistant Bishop in Wakefield, Oxford, Lincoln, Gloucester and Europe.

People will remember him fondly as a wonderful pastor, unfailingly kind and attentive, developing the gifts of others and nurturing the faith of new Christians.
